The NLTAPA Professional Development Workgroup (PD Workgroup) is focused on helping our peers, from seasoned veterans to newcomers. With a focus on enhancing operational knowledge of Center leaders and their staff, the PD Workgroup is dedicated to providing support and training.

Peer-to-Peer Mentor Program

We encourage both new and experienced LTAP professionals to join our Peer-to-Peer Mentor Program.  Created to foster relationships and communication between NLTAPA members, the program matches individuals with similar professional interests and encourages knowledge-sharing, collaboration, and mentoring.
